The full answer to this question is very complex, but we’ve broken it down into just three overarching reasons:
- Athletic performance is quantified, academic performance is qualified.
- Athletic statistics are public knowledge, academic statistics are closely guarded.
- Athletic heroes are recognized in the early stages of their careers, academic heroes are only noted at the end stages of their careers.

There is a subtle but very important difference between how we identify athletic heroes and how we identify academic heroes. We quantify our athletic heroes, but we qualify our academic ones. This changes everything.
In 2003, a struggling team in the National Basketball Association picked up a lanky 19 year old from Akron, Ohio in the draft. The young man was drafted straight out of high school, but had been talked about as an up and coming NBA star for years thanks to his electrifying play on his local high school team. Before the end of his rookie year, everyone knew the name of Lebron James. He was quickly vaulted into the upper echelon of basketball stars shared by greats such as Michael Jordan, Shaquille O’neal, Kobe Bryant, and many others. In his rookie year, Lebron racked up some powerful stats. He scored 25 points on his first game in the NBA, setting a record for most points scored by a prep-to-pro player in his debut game. Over the course of the entire season he averaged 20.9 points, 5.5 rebounds, and 5.9 assists per game. At the time, this put him on par with just two other players in the history of the NBA who had achieved these numbers – Oscar Robertson and Michael Jordan.
Lebron James continued to put up unbelievable statistics year after year. He was awarded the 2004 Rookie of the year award, won three NBA Championships, was recognized as the NBA’s Most Valuable Player 4 times, and was awarded two Olympic medals. Lebron James quickly became recognized as one of the greatest athletic heroes of the modern age!

PUBLIC STATISTICSÂ vs. PRIVATE METRICS
In the NBA, statistics are tracked for all competitions and they become public knowledge as soon as they’re identified. In fact every major professional sports industry publishes detailed statistics on their players. They are tracked on everything from the number of passes to the number of free throws made, to number of fouls, and on and on. By evaluating all the players on the same quantitative metrics it becomes very clear that Lebron James’s performance is exceptional among his peers. We can see immediately that his ability to put up more than 20 points per game in his rookie season was an incredible feat that virtually no one else in the NBA had achieved. America’s youth were given explicit information that identified Lebron James as an incredible basketball player. He was a hero that students could aspire to not just because someone said he was good, but because there was clear, publicly available information that demonstrated exactly how good he was relative to others.
Students could watch Lebron James and talk about his amazing performances using quantified metrics. They could show off their knowledge of Lebron’s skills by noting the outstanding statistics of his career. The detailed performance numbers from his games allowed for a clear cut comparison to others in the league. They said to us, this is someone to be emulated! Lebron James was a hero, clean and simple. And everyone knew it.
In academic industries, where our heroes come from abilities of the mind, we have no such public knowledge of performance metrics. We do have one system setup to evaluate performance in academic settings and to some extent grades can help inspire students do better; however, for the most part, grades are seen as very poor, uninspired, evaluation criteria. Its easy to see that grades don’t create the same hero-generating effect that sports statistics do. There are three key differences that make it hard for students to use grades to identify academic heroes: (1) Grades are not made publicly available, (2) Grades are not directly correlated to real-world performance, (3) grades are not normalized, an “A” from one school, could be very different from an “A” from another.
There are no organizing bodies to post grades from college exams, nor are there other ways to compare the performances of top scientists in their field. The ability to quickly see statistics from all performers and compare them to one another is a key factor in being able to define a hero. This simply does not exist in academics the way it does in athletics.

There are ways we recognize heroes in academic fields; however, most of these are in the form of recognition awards given at the end-stages of an academic’s career. Lebron James was 19 when he was drafted to the NBA and began putting up amazing statistics. The average age of Nobel Laureates is 59. These recognition awards are often given based upon a subjective private review of performance where the criteria are not well defined nor provided to the public. This fact makes it even harder for students to look at an academic and see without a doubt that there performance is exceptional above and beyond others in their field. Identifying and recognizing “active heroes” at the early stages of their careers is critical to motivating and inspiring youth to want to emulate the heroes.
